Cargo Vessel 'Diaa' Held in Stylida After Inspection Reveals Major Deficiencies
On June 7, 2017, the cargo ship 'Diaa' was apprehended in the afternoon during a thorough inspection conducted by an Authorized Inspector from the Main Inspection Bureau of Thessaloniki. The inspection uncovered significant violations pertaining to Annex X of CM 2009/16/EC, prompting the Port Authority of Stylida to initiate planned administrative sanctions against the vessel.
